Job Description

Description

We are looking for a Data Analyst Intern to join FDR Financial Group, a leading financial services company. As a Data Analyst Intern, you will play a crucial role in analyzing and interpreting complex data sets to help drive business decisions and strategies. This internship offers a valuable opportunity to gain hands-on experience in the financial industry and develop essential analytical skills.

As a Data Analyst Intern at FDR Financial Group, you will work on a variety of projects involving data collection, cleansing, and visualization. Your insights and recommendations will directly impact the company's operations and contribute to its overall success. This role is ideal for individuals interested in data analysis, financial services, and gaining practical experience in a dynamic remote work environment.

Responsibilities:

  • Collect and analyze data to identify trends and patterns.
  • Assist in preparing reports and presentations based on data findings.
  • Collaborate with team members to support data-driven decision-making processes.
  • Conduct quality assurance checks on data to ensure accuracy and reliability.
  • Utilize data visualization tools to present information in a clear and concise manner.
  • Assist in developing and maintaining databases for data storage and retrieval.
  • Support the implementation of data analytics solutions and strategies.
  • Stay updated on industry trends and best practices in data analysis.

Requirements:

  • Pursuing a degree in Data Science, Statistics, Mathematics, Economics, or related field.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ret complex data sets.
  • Proficiency in data analysis tools such as Excel, SQL, or Python.
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y in data interpretation.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ment.
  • Good communication skills to present findings and insights effectively.
  • Basic understanding of financial concepts and terminology is a plus.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and a proactive attitude towards learning.
